The invoice audit log allows you to keep track of the date and time a user shared an invoice and who it was shared with.


How does the invoice audit work?

The invoice audit log records any time the invoice is sent and shared in Synergy and who with, this includes:

  • The time and date an invoice was sent using the 'send' button and who it was sent to.

  • The time and date an invoice was shared using the portal button and who it was shared with.

Columns on the invoice audit log

Date - This shows the date and time of the entry in the audit log

User - This shows the User that created the invoice audit log entry

Text - This shows you the action that was completed that resulted in an invoice audit log entry including how the invoice was shared and who with.

Where is the invoice audit log?

  1. Organisation drop down > Invoices.

  2. Click into the invoice you would like to audit.

  3. Select the action dropdown arrow in the top right hand corner > audit log

Reporting on the invoice audit log

You can report on the invoice audit log under the category 'invoices' in reports.

To be able to view the invoice audit information, you will firstly need to add an invoice audit filter. To do this, customise the report, then select the filter icon

Add a filter for invoice audit activity type and check the activity types you would like to view on your report, this will populate the report columns.

Press 'OK' in the top right hand corner and Save

The columns you can report on are below:

Invoice Audit Activity Type - This shows the activity type of the audit log, for example invoice send or invoice share

Invoice Audit Sent Date - This column shows the date and time the invoice was sent/shared.

Invoice Audit Staff Name - This column populates with the staff member that shared the invoice.

Invoice Audit Staff Email - This will show the email of the staff member that sent or shared the invoice.

Invoice Audit Contact Contact Email - This will bring through the email of the contact or staff member this invoice was shared with.

Invoice Audit Contact Contact Name - This will shows the populate with the name of the contact or staff member this invoice was shared with.


Tip!
If you have an audit entry for your invoice, but the client has not received it (after checking spam/junk) - check that your user profile has both a First name and a Last name. Having only one name will stop invoices being sent.
